Troubleshooting Common SMTP Server Issues
Experiencing errors with your mail delivery? Addressing typical SMTP system issues can be surprisingly straightforward. Initially , verify your external SMTP server settings, including the host name, gateway , and username . Faulty credentials are a common source of failures . read more Next, check if your system is listed on any blocklists ; removal steps can take time . Moreover, ensure your firewall isn't preventing outbound data on the required channel. Finally, analyze your mail logs for specific error messages that suggest the root cause . Consider contacting your provider for support if the trouble persists.

Secure SMTP: Best Practices and Encryption
To maintain steady and secure email delivery, implementing secure SMTP approaches is essential. Utilizing Transport Layer Security (TLS) or Secure Sockets Layer (SSL) – though SSL is gradually deprecated – offers coding for both the request phase and the data phase of the SMTP process. Always configure your SMTP platform to demand TLS coding and remove previous SSL versions. Furthermore, implementing strong passwords and regularly changing them is an important part of securing your SMTP setup. Finally, observe your records for unusual activity to detect and address potential security risks promptly.
